Frequently Asked Questions

What are the main symptoms of depression?

Core symptoms include persistent sadness or emptiness, loss of interest in activities you used to enjoy, sleep or appetite disturbances, fatigue, and difficulty concentrating.

How long does depression therapy take?

Therapy for mild-to-moderate depression typically lasts 3–6 months. Severe or recurrent depression may require longer treatment or a combination with medication.

Is CBT effective for depression?

Yes.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T) is one of the best-evidenced treatments for depression. It focuses on identifying negative thought patterns and replacing them with realistic alternatives.

When is medication needed for depression?

Medication is usually considered for moderate-to-severe depression or when psychotherapy alone is insufficient. This decision is made by a psychiatrist in collaboration with the patient.

Can I treat depression with online therapy?

Yes. Research shows that video-based psychotherapy for depression is as effective as in-person sessions, especially for mild-to-moderate episodes.
